Bootstrapper Community vs Corporate Innovation Lab in Entrepreneurship

Bootstrapped entrepreneurs rely on limited resources and organic growth strategies, fostering agility and customer-centric innovation within the Bootstrapper community. Corporate innovation labs, funded by established companies, focus on developing breakthrough technologies and scaling solutions through structured R&D and access to extensive market networks. Why it is important

Understanding the difference between Bootstrapper communities and Corporate innovation labs is crucial for entrepreneurs to align their strategies with appropriate resources and risk levels. Bootstrappers focus on self-funding and organic growth, promoting agility and individual ownership. Corporate innovation labs leverage organizational resources, offering structured support but often with hierarchical constraints. Recognizing these distinctions helps entrepreneurs optimize networking, funding approaches, and innovation processes tailored to their startup's stage and culture.

Comparison Table

Aspect Bootstrapper Community Corporate Innovation Lab
Funding Self-funded or small angel investments Allocated corporate budget and resources
Decision-Making Founder-driven, fast and flexible Structured, involves multiple stakeholders
Risk Tolerance High risk, high reward mindset Moderate risk, risk managed by company policies
Innovation Speed Rapid experimentation and iteration Slower due to bureaucratic processes
Resource Access Limited resources, focused on lean operations Access to extensive corporate infrastructure and networks
Goal Focus Building sustainable independent businesses Driving strategic growth and corporate transformation
Community Support Peer-driven, collaborative entrepreneur networks Internal cross-department collaboration and expert mentorship
Scalability Organic growth dependent on market traction Rapid scaling via corporate channels and partnerships

Which is better?

Bootstrapper communities foster organic growth and resilience by leveraging limited resources and emphasizing grassroots support, making them ideal for early-stage startups focused on self-sufficiency. Corporate innovation labs benefit from substantial funding, access to advanced technologies, and established networks, accelerating product development and market entry for intrapreneurial ventures. Choosing between the two depends on whether agility and independence or resource availability and scale drive the entrepreneurial goals.
